#5b1300 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5b1300 is composed of 35.7% red, 7.5%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 100%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 12.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 17.8%. #5b1300 color hex could be obtained by blending #b62600 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

● #5b1300 color description : Very dark red.
#5b1300 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5b1300 has RGB values of R:91, G:19,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:1,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 5968640.
